Nutrition:  Women generally determine how their households eat.  From eating habits to food selection as well as how the food is prepared.  Here are some healthy low-carb food options:  mushrooms, peppers, fish, avocados, cabbage, carrots, spinach, turnips, cauliflower, broccoli and asparagus.  Looking for a healthy snack?  Try almonds, walnuts, cashew nuts, pumpkin seeds or biltong.  Also make sure to include a lot of water in your daily life.

Body Health:  Some medical conditions that are of great concern to women include: breast cancer, heart disease, PCOS and depression.  Have a diet with less processed foods and a variety of fresh fruit and vegetables.  Also eat leaner cuts of meat and fish as well as leaner cuts of meat and fish and choose foods that are high in fibre.  Healthy eating will also help you maintain your weight which is important because being overweight can lead to a variety of diseases.  No matter what stage of her life – women deal with a lot of pressure and stress from the different hats that she has to wear.  Try to manage your stress levels through relaxation techniques such as meditation.

Physical Activity:  Physical activity should be fun for everyone.  Include physical activities in your lifestyle such as: taking walks around the neighborhood, cycling, gardening, yoga, rock climbing, hiking as well as dancing or group sport activities like netball.  The benefits of engaging in physical activity include:

  • Strong heart and lungs
  • Weight control
  • Regulated blood pressure
  • Improved energy levels
  • Cancer prevention
  • Reduced blood sugar levels
  • Clear arteries and veins
  • Strong bones.

Here is a delicious recipe from The Diet Everyone Talks About “Eat Slim” recipe book that you can use to make “Scrumptious Mince and Dumpling Bake” for your next gathering with your friends and family.

Portions: 6
Prep Time:  30 min
CHD:  18 g per portion
kJ;  1 100 kJ

Ingredients:

15 ml Canola / olive oil
1 large Oni0on, chopped
800 g Lean beef mince
50 ml Soya flour / whole wheat flour
30 ml Water

Dumplings:

500 ml Spinach, destalked, chopped and cooked in the microwave for 8 minutes
250 ml Whole wheat self-raising flour
To taste Salt, pepper mixed spice
30 ml Canola oil / olive oil
1 Egg, well beaten150 ml Cream

Method:

  1. Preheat oven to 180 degrees Celsius.
  2. Fry the onion in the heated oil till translucent.
  3. Add meat and stir-fry till brown.
  4. Add the rest of the ingredients and cook for 10 minutes very slowly. Stir occasionally.
  5. Place mince in a greased baking dish with lid.

Dumplings:

  1. Mix dry ingredients.
  2. Add the rest of the ingredients.
  3. Spoon dumplings (teaspoon size) onto the mince.
  4. Cover.
  5. Bake at 180 degrees Celsius for 30 minutes.

Note:  Can be prepared without dumplings – 9 carbohydrates per portion.
